Since opening its first store in 1975, Pinch A Penny, A POOLCORP Company, has become the largest franchised retail pool, patio and spa company. This first store evolved into a full-time, full-service retail pool supply store offering everything needed to operate and enjoy a swimming pool or spa. Job Summary:

Pinch A Penny is hiring a hands-on merchandising leader to modernize and build out merchandising, purchasing, and inventory management across its 300+ franchise locations. The role owns system-wide merchandising strategy, vendor purchasing/management, inventory planning and replenishment, and store ordering support, with a focus on improving processes, aligning execution across functions, and providing strong franchisee support. The ideal candidate is an operational “builder” with strong merchandising judgment, analytical skills, and disciplined execution.

Responsibilities:

Merchandising & Assortment Strategy

  • Leads merchandising strategies across core retail categories to improve sales, margin, inventory productivity, and franchisee profitability.

  • Builds and develops a high-performing team focused on ownership, execution, continuous improvement, and franchisee support.

  • Analyzes sales trends, customer behavior, and seasonal demand to optimize assortments, pricing, and promotional effectiveness.

  • Identifies opportunities for bundled solutions, private label expansion, category growth, and differentiated product offerings.

  • Partners with Marketing and Operations to support promotional execution, seasonal merchandising, and the in-store customer experience.

Purchasing, Inventory & Replenishment

  • Leads the purchasing team responsible for vendor purchasing, replenishment, inventory planning, and store ordering support.

  • Builds and maintains reporting, KPIs, and dashboards covering inventory productivity, category performance, and replenishment execution.

  • Improves inventory turns, fill rates, forecasting accuracy, replenishment discipline, and overall inventory health across the system.

  • Supports franchisees with merchandising initiatives, inventory planning, promotional execution, and store ordering.

  • Works closely with Supply Chain and vendors to improve inventory flow, purchasing execution, and product availability.

Vendor & Supplier Management

  • Develops and manages strategic vendor and supplier relationships across key merchandise categories.

  • Partners with vendors on promotional planning, new product introductions, assortment optimization, private label expansion, and opportunities to improve product differentiation, pricing, and category performance.

  • Holds vendor partners accountable to fill rates, lead times, service levels, and operational performance, leveraging sales and inventory data to support purchasing and inventory planning decisions.
